A new priority under the Environment Programme provides over €180 million for water sustainability
18 Mar, 2026 | 11:45
The European Commission (EC) has approved an amendment to the Environment Program 2021-2027, creating a new priority – “Water Sustainability”. An Infringement procedure against Bulgaria for lack of access to justice over air quality has been closed
12 Mar, 2026 | 14:59
The European Commission (EC) has closed the infringement procedure against Bulgaria for lack of access to justice in the field of ambient air quality. The EC decision was taken on 11 March 2026 following a positive assessment of the legislative changes made by Bulgaria.
